    So my good friend rob heard tell that i was kinda looking for a model A project. Like i need another project right? Well anyway, he told me about this A pickup that he'd know about for 40 years, and just so happens to know the fella who owns it. So he sets up a time with the fella so we can drive out to look at this car. Well i take some cash with me and set off with my buddy eric, My buddy JJ (60galaxieJJ) and Rob toward the great south in search of model A greatness. So we show up and this is what i buy.

    Its a 1928 Ford model A Roadster Pickup. SCORE!!!!!:D

    Best part is that its even got a clear WA state ***le and you guys will hate me for the price i paid. Its less than most people pay for doors.

    Here it is mocked up in the garage so i could sit in it and make car noises
